We are well into 2025 now that February has arrived, and that means that many of us have goals and ambitions to change our lifestyles for the better, at least for a little while. One super popular diet that many race to when they want to shed fat is the keto diet.

The keto diet is all about getting your body into a state of ketosis. Basically, that’s where it burns fat rather than carbohydrates for fuel. So, the idea is to consume a very small percentage of calories from carbohydrates (5-10% of calories from carbohydrates and the remainder is made up of fats). That way, your body has no choice but to burn fat to keep itself going each day. To get into this state of ketosis, you really have to watch what you eat, as there are carbohydrates in almost everything!  This diet can feel a bit restricting and your meal options become very limited. But, if you do have an untamable sweet tooth, there’s no need to worry! According to dieticians, there are a few keto-friendly fruit options out there that are perfect for using as a keto-friendly dessert alternative!

  1. Avocados
  2. Coconuts
  3. Blackberries
  4. Strawberries
  5. Raspberries
  6. Cranberries
  7. Kiwi
  8. Startfruit
  9. Pumpkin
  10. Gooseberries

While it is still a pretty limited list, it’s definitely better than nothing! You can snack on these fruits plain, make smoothies, or mix them into full-fat yogurt for a yummy dessert that won’t break your diet!
